Rakeback and Cashback Programs

These are staples for high-volume players and are often automatically applied or require minimal interaction to claim. Experienced gamblers highly value these programs as they provide a continuous return on their wagers, effectively reducing the house edge over time. The „claiming” frequency for these is high, often daily or weekly, as they represent a consistent, low-effort benefit. These are considered a non-negotiable part of their long-term strategy.

The Strategic Claimer vs. The Opportunistic Claimer

The core difference in bonus claiming frequency at BC.Game, especially among experienced gamblers, lies in their approach: * **Strategic Claimers:** These players meticulously analyse every bonus offer. They calculate the expected value, consider the wagering requirements in relation to their preferred games’ contribution rates, and factor in the time commitment. Their claiming frequency is lower but highly effective, focusing on maximising profit and minimising risk. They might skip several offers to wait for one that perfectly aligns with their strategy. * **Opportunistic Claimers:** While still experienced, these players might claim a broader range of bonuses, especially if the terms appear superficially attractive or if they are readily available. Their frequency is higher, but their overall profitability from bonuses might be lower due to less stringent evaluation of terms and conditions. They might claim a bonus simply because it’s there, rather than because it’s optimal.
